While is often cited as one of the greatest F1 games ever made, it is important to note that it was a PlayStation 3 exclusive and was never officially released for PC. Modern PC players typically experience it through the RPCS3 emulator , which allows the game to run at higher resolutions and frame rates than the original hardware.
